The first step in paper bag manufacturing is sourcing the right materials. High-quality paper is crucial to ensure durability and resistance to tearing. Manufacturers often opt for recycled paper to promote sustainability, as it helps reduce waste and lowers the carbon footprint. Once the paper has been selected, it is carefully inspected to eliminate any defects or contaminants that could compromise the final product’s quality.

The next step involves the printing and design phase. Paper bags can be customized to meet the specific requirements of each client. This process utilizes advanced printing techniques to create eye-catching designs and logos that effectively promote brand awareness. The printing can be done on the paper rolls before they are transformed into bags or directly on the flat sheets used to manufacture the bags later.

Once the design is finalized, the actual production of the bags begins. The paper rolls are fed into a machine known as the bag-making machine, where they undergo a series of intricate and precise operations. The machine cuts the paper into the appropriate size and shape, using specially designed knives and tools. It then folds the paper, applying adhesive to secure the sides together. To enhance the bag’s strength, a reinforcing sheet may be added to the bottom and handles are often attached.

The manufacturing process also involves the application of various finishing techniques. These include the addition of laminated coatings to provide a glossy or matte finish, as well as coatings that offer water resistance or protection against grease and stains. These coatings not only improve the bag’s aesthetic appeal but also enhance its functional properties, making it suitable for a wide range of applications.

Quality control is an integral part of the paper bag manufacturing process. Throughout the production line, bags are constantly examined to ensure they meet the highest standards. This involves checking for any defects or inconsistencies, verifying the dimensions, and confirming the adherence to the design specifications. Any bags that do not meet the quality criteria are rejected and discarded, ensuring that only the best products make it to the market.

In recent years, there has been a growing demand for sustainable alternatives to plastic bags. This has led to the rise of eco-friendly paper bag manufacturing. Manufacturers are now exploring innovative ways to produce bags that are not only recyclable but also biodegradable. They are experimenting with different materials, such as compostable papers and vegetable-based inks, to reduce the environmental impact of paper bag production.
